PAWTUCKET – The offseason isn’t even a week hold, yet the Pawtucket Red Sox already have a major item on their to-do list: Select a manager for the 2019 season.

Red Sox vice president of player development Ben Crockett confirmed that Kevin Boles will not be returning for what would have been his sixth season as Pawtucket’s manager. Boles was not under contract for 2019 but Crockett noted that Boles has decided to seek opportunities elsewhere.


Boles’ five-year run as Pawtucket’s skipper saw him guide the Triple-A club to the 2014 Governors’ Cup and manage current Red Sox contributors Mookie Betts, Rafael Devers, Jackie Bradley Jr., Brian Johnson, and Blake Swihart. Boles had managed in the Boston farm system since 2008, starting out in Single-A Greenville with stops also in Salem and Portland before reaching Pawtucket.
